Prof. Ankita Thakkar
Assistant Professor
Ankita Thakkar is an Assistant Professor in Computer Science and Engineering (AI & ML) at the School of Engineering, Dayananda Sagar University. She completed her B.E. and M.E. in Information Technology from Mumbai University. She also holds an M.S. in Computer Science and Engineering from the University of Nevada, Reno, USA, and is currently pursuing a Doctor of Business Administration from the Swiss School of Business Management, Geneva.
Ankita has over 12 years of teaching and significant industry experience in full-stack development, product management, curriculum development, and instructional design. Her expertise spans areas such as Machine Learning, Deep Learning, Natural Language Processing (NLP), Cybersecurity, and Game Theory.She has held leadership roles in various EdTech organizations, where she developed educational solutions and trained educators. She is also a recipient of the Dean’s Merit Scholarship from the University of Nevada, Reno, and has received multiple awards for excellence in teaching and curriculum development.
In research, Ankita has contributed to Game Theory, Machine Learning, Natural Language Processing (NLP), Cybersecurity, and Privacy Preservation, publishing a paper in an international conference and two in journals. She is passionate about bridging the gap between academia and industry.Ankita has authored a book on Core Java Programming and contributed to AI curriculum development for multiple academic institutions and EdTech companies. She has actively mentored students in AI and ML projects, focusing on predictive analytics, recommendation systems, and cybersecurity strategies.
Research Interests:
- Game Theory in AI and Cybersecurity
- Machine Learning & Predictive Analytics
- Natural Language Processing (NLP) & Sentiment Analysis
- Cybersecurity & Privacy Preservation in AI
- Recommendation Systems
